Output 96c5697d370c3a6d372011525a0cab5932c1c16ec894b01d262af3fe23d7f4ab:1

value
31883555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560c6282342d44d8cba7def2bfa05e41ed414442 OP_EQUAL
address
39XzsYyYW5bdiZQWeKTSfwHVyq6nqFiQe3
transaction
96c5697d370c3a6d372011525a0cab5932c1c16ec894b01d262af3fe23d7f4ab
confirmations
354166
spent
true